Output 3aa31a26bcf136d98c310b4a5e729b259735401f4239548d64916cd01193033b:3

value
213500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f13cfaeb965af007f082e7f86c9cf68d78538a05 OP_EQUAL
address
3PgZpkUubsX4SytfzeWjpVDwLc1aVahwVv
transaction
3aa31a26bcf136d98c310b4a5e729b259735401f4239548d64916cd01193033b
confirmations
181485
spent
true